Examination methods in case of diseases of the cardiovascular systemDasernes heart and a healthy circulatory system are the basis for a fulfilling life. Unfortunately, diseases of the cardiovascular system are among the most common causes of death worldwide. To detect such diseases in a timely manner and to treat effectively, are Doctors today, a variety of research methods available.One of the first and most important diagnostic measures the physical examination. The doctor measures the blood pressure, examining the pulse and listens to the heart. Here already the first indications of possible problems you can get — such as irregular heartbeat, a heart murmur, or a striking high or low blood pressure.Another standard method, the electrocardiogram (ECG) is. The electrical activities of the heart are recorded. The ECG allows to detect heart rhythm disorders, signs of inflammation of the heart muscle or heart attack. It is fast, inexpensive and non-invasive, therefore, it is used in many cases as an initial diagnostic.To assess the function and structure of the heart in more detail, the echocardiography (ultrasound of the heart) to be used. This method shows the movement of the heart valves, the wall motion of the heart muscle and the size of the chambers of the heart. In addition, the Discharge capacity of the heart (ejection fraction) to determine an important Parameter in the diagnosis of heart failure.For a detailed presentation of the heart and coronary vessels, the coronary angiography is used. A contrast agent is injected into the vessels, and with x-rays is recorded. This study is considered the gold standard for the diagnosis of stenosis or occlusions of the coronary arteries, which can lead to a heart attack.In the last years picture imaging procedures such as computed tomography (CT) and mag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) of the heart is important. The cardiac CT is well suited for the visualization of calcifications in the coronary arteries and for the assessment of vascular gradients. The cardiac MRI provides high-resolution images of the heart tissue, and allows for the distinction between living and dead tissue, especially important after a heart attack.In addition, there are stress tests, in which the function of the heart during physical exertion is monitored. To do this, the treadmill‑ECG or stress echocardiography count. These Tests help to detect heart diseases, which are in a state of rest visible, such as a coronary heart disease.Finally, laboratory investigations play an important role. Certain enzymes and proteins in the blood, such as Troponin and NT‑proBNP, can indicate damage to the heart muscle or heart failure.Conclusion: The diversity of research methods enables accurate diagnosis of cardiovascular diseases. Through the targeted use of these procedures, Doctors can intervene at an early stage and so the lives of many patients to save. Medicines for the prevention of cardiovascular diseases: A vital building block for healthCardiovascular disease causes are the most frequent causes of death worldwide. According to the statistics of the world health organization (WHO), cases every year, millions of death — and yet a majority of these cases can be achieved by preventive measures to prevent it. An important role in medicines that were developed specifically for the prevention of this disease.What exactly is the prevention of drugs? It is drug, to seizures, the risk of heart attacks, strokes and other cardiovascular diseases is lower. Among the most commonly prescribed drugs:Statins: lower the level of cholesterol in the blood and thus prevent the formation of deposits in the vessels.Blood pressure lowering drugs (e.g. ACE‑inhibitors or beta-blockers): they regulate the blood pressure and relieve the pressure on the heart.Anticoagulants (for example, acetylsalicylic acid): they prevent the formation of blood clots, which can lead to blockages of the blood vessels.Anticoagulants: you can reduce the clotting ability of the blood and protect against thrombosis and embolism.The drugs, however, are not a panacea. Their effectiveness is shown at its best in combination with a healthy lifestyle. Regular physical activity, a balanced diet with lots of fiber, vegetables and fruits, and avoiding Smoking and moderate alcohol consumption are the cornerstone of prevention.Another important aspect is the individual adjustment of therapy. Not every drug works for every patient. Doctors take into account when prescribing:the individual risk profile (e.g., family medical history, age, Presence of Diabetes);existing diseases;possible side effects and interactions with other drugs.Despite the advantages, there are also points of criticism. Some proponents of a natural preventive and hold the widespread regulation of prevention medication for excessive. They argue that a healthy lifestyle alone is often sufficient. In addition, medications can have side effects of muscle pain with statins to bleeding with anticoagulants.Conclusion: medication for prevention of cardiovascular diseases are an effective tool in modern medicine that can save lives. But they must be used responsibly and individually. The best prevention is a smart Mix of medication and health-conscious behavior.
